RNA-Seq Data Mining: Downregulation of NeuroD6 Serves as a Possible Biomarker for Alzheimer’s Disease Brains

Table 4

The set of 12 DEGs downregulated in the hippocampus of Japanese AD patients identified by microarray data analysis of GSE36980 corresponding to RNA-Seq data analysis of SRA060752.

The set of 31 DEGs downregulated in the hippocampus of Japanese AD patients satisfying value <0.005 by two-tailed -test and fold change smaller than 0.6 were extracted by microarray data analysis of GSE36980. Among them, the set of 12 genes corresponding to the core set of 522 DEGs identified by RNA-Seq data analysis of SRA060572 are listed with Entrez Gene ID, gene symbol, gene name, fold change, and value. NeuroD6 is italicized. The complete list of 31 DEGs are shown in Supplementary Table  5.
